We are looking for volunteers to support and actively listen to bereaved people within a community group
environment.
· To support at a friendly, informal face to face group, be there to offer people time to talk and share their
experiences of grief.

· To complete mandatory training and attend training throughout the year supporting your role.

· To be able to work closely with other volunteers in a group environment, offer peer support to other
volunteers if needed.

· Have the confidence to engage with a varied group of bereaved people within the session.

· To be able to assess and provide information or signpost to other organisations when needed.

· To be available to work on a rota with other volunteers and be able to facilitate the group.

· Be aware of your community setting, housekeeping, risk assessments, first aid kits.

· To maintain records of attendance in line with Sue Ryder policies and procedures.

· Attend regular group supervision sessions with your family support team
